    Also, mention to her that if he (I think you said it was a male?) eats too much fish related food (either nibble or wet food), she may wanna consider cutting down and replacing it with chicken or turkey or rabbit. Male cats, especially, can suffer from that if they have too much fish in their diet because it crystallizes in their urine and they can’t pee. Just a tip!
